Top General Pushes for an Exit Strategy as Iran War Reaches a Crossroads

TL;DR Summary
Chairman of the Joint Chiefs Gen. Dan Caine has privately urged Trump advisers to find an off-ramp from the Iran conflict, arguing that escalation options are limited and airpower alone won’t meet President Trump’s objectives. He’s discussed concerns with other top officials, including Ratcliffe, Rubio and Vance, while highlighting dwindling U.S. munitions stocks and the risks of ground combat. The goal is to avoid a broader war while seeking a “symbolic” win (potentially reopening the Strait of Hormuz) that could support any diplomatic path, all while carefully managing his relationship with Trump.
